WebJul 6, 2024 · The term “inchoate” means “secret.” The State of Connecticut does not record this inchoate lien on the land records of any town. Rather, when someone dies in Connecticut owning an interest in real property, the State of Connecticut has an unrecorded – inchoate – lien (for the taxes) on the decedent’s real estate. WebIn any action involving the judicial sale of real property for the purpose of satisfying the claims of creditors of an owner of an interest in the property, the spouse of the owner may be made a party to the action, and the dower interest of the spouse, whether inchoate or otherwise, may be subjected to the sale without the consent of the spouse.
